Notation, Zeros, and Digits for 10^1191
The standard power notation for this number is 10^1191. This compact form clearly indicates its magnitude. When written out in full, trecentsexnonagintillion would appear as the digit '1' followed by a staggering 1191 zeros. Consequently, the total number of digits in this colossal figure is 1192 (the initial '1' plus the 1191 zeros).
In scientific notation, this value is expressed as 1 x 10^1191. This representation is particularly useful for handling extremely large or small numbers, as it simplifies calculations and makes the scale immediately apparent. The exponent, 1191, directly tells us the number of places the decimal point would be shifted to the right from its position after the '1'.

Frequently Asked Questions About Trecentsexnonagintillion
What is trecentsexnonagintillion?
Trecentsexnonagintillion is a very large number precisely defined as 10^1191, which means it is the digit 1 followed by 1191 zeros.
How many digits does 10^1191 have?
The number 10^1191 has a total of 1192 digits. This includes the leading digit '1' and the 1191 zeros that follow it.
How many zeros are in trecentsexnonagintillion?
There are exactly 1191 zeros in trecentsexnonagintillion when written out in standard form.
What is the scientific notation for this number?
The scientific notation for trecentsexnonagintillion is 1 x 10^1191, which clearly expresses its magnitude using a base-10 exponent.
Is trecentsexnonagintillion a real number?
Yes, trecentsexnonagintillion is a real, positive integer. It is a precisely defined power of ten, representing a concrete value within the number system.
How does this value compare to a googol?
Trecentsexnonagintillion (10^1191) is vastly larger than a googol, which is 10^100. The exponent 1191 is significantly greater than 100, indicating a much higher order of magnitude.
